Here are the steps to follow to become an Advertising Executive:

1. Earn a Bachelor’s Degree: In order to become an Advertising Executive, having a bachelor’s degree in marketing, communications or public relations is essential. Furthermore, some employers prefer that the degree be from a well-known university.

2. Gain Experience: Most employers look for candidates who have at least three years of experience working in the marketing field. This experience can come from internships, volunteer positions or entry-level roles within the field of advertising.

3. Develop Your Skills: Advertising Executives must have strong skills in many areas such as writing, design, research and communication. It is also important to be creative and have a good understanding of technology used for advertising purposes such as social media and web design platforms.

4. Get Certified: Becoming certified in relevant areas of advertising such as digital marketing or copywriting can demonstrate your knowledge and skills to potential employers.

5. Network: Networking with professionals in the industry can give you access to job opportunities that may not be advertised publicly or even help you develop relationships with potential clients or contacts within the industry that could help your career moving forward as an Advertising Executive.

Education and Training Requirements for an Advertising Executive

Advertising executives are responsible for overseeing the marketing and advertising campaigns of their organization. To become an advertising executive, individuals must typically have a bachelor’s degree in a field related to advertising, such as marketing, communications or public relations. A degree in business or finance may also be beneficial.

Along with educational qualifications, potential advertising executives should possess excellent communication, leadership and organizational skills. They must also have a strong understanding of digital marketing and social media outlets to effectively create campaigns that reach their target audience.

In addition to formal education requirements, many employers prefer candidates who have experience in the field of advertising. Some employers provide on-the-job training for new hires to ensure they understand their responsibilities and can work with other members of the team. Most organizations also require candidates to have knowledge of basic computer programs used in the industry, such as Adobe Photoshop and Microsoft Office Suite.

Advertising executives should have a solid understanding of current trends and best practices in the industry to create successful campaigns that meet their client’s objectives. The ability to think creatively is essential for problem solving when challenges arise during the course of working on a project. It is also important for them to stay up-to-date with advances in digital technologies that can improve the effectiveness of an advertisement campaign.

Developing Strategies for Advertising Campaigns

Creating a strong and successful advertising campaign requires careful planning and consideration of the target audience, budget, and objectives. It is essential to have an overarching strategy for developing an effective advertising campaign that will reach the target audience and achieve desired results.

The first step in developing a strategy for an advertising campaign is to identify the target audience. This involves researching the demographics of the potential customer base, such as age, gender, income level, location, interests, and more. Once this research is completed, it will be easier to create ads that are tailored specifically to this target audience.

The second step in developing a strategy for an advertising campaign is to set a budget. This budget should include both money spent on creating ads as well as money spent on media placement. Once this budget is set, it will be easier to determine which types of media are available within the allotted amount of money.

The third step in developing a strategy for an advertising campaign is to set clear objectives. These objectives should be measurable goals that can be tracked over time in order to assess the success of the campaign. Examples of objectives may include increasing brand awareness or driving sales conversions.

Finally, once all these steps have been completed, it is important to monitor and adjust the strategy over time if necessary in order to ensure that it remains effective and relevant. Keeping track of metrics such as ad impressions or click-through rates can help determine how successful the campaigns are in reaching their intended audiences and achieving desired results.
